Product Overview

The Sunsynk SS-12kW-LLKS-HYB-3P-IP65-04 is a 12kW three-phase hybrid inverter designed for demanding residential, commercial and agricultural solar power systems requiring high-capacity backup power, battery integration and advanced energy management. Featuring dual MPPT tracking, support for LiFePO4 and lead-acid battery systems, and an IP65-rated enclosure, this inverter is suitable for larger hybrid solar installations in South African conditions.

Key Features

  • 12kW three-phase hybrid inverter suitable for solar, backup power and energy storage applications.
  • Compatible with both LiFePO4 and lead-acid battery systems.
  • Dual MPPT trackers help optimise solar production across multiple PV strings.
  • IP65-rated enclosure designed for indoor or protected outdoor installation environments.
  • Supports up to 18000W PV input capacity for larger solar array installations.
  • Fast 10ms transfer time assists with seamless backup switching during grid interruptions.
  • Up to 97.6% maximum efficiency for efficient power conversion.
  • Integrated protection features including overload, short circuit and over-temperature protection.

Technical Specifications

Specification Detail
Brand Sunsynk
Model SS-12kW-LLKS-HYB-3P-IP65-04
Product Type Three-Phase Hybrid Inverter
Rated Output Power 12000W
Max. Apparent Output Power 12000VA
Peak Output Apparent Power 24000VA
Supported Battery Type LiFePO4 or Lead-Acid
Battery Input Voltage Range 40V – 60V
Max. Charge Voltage 60V (Configurable)
Max. Charge Current 220A (Configurable)
Max. Discharge Current 260A (Configurable)
Recommended Battery Capacity 100Ah – 2000Ah
Max. PV Input Power 18000W
Max. DC Input Voltage 800V
MPPT Voltage Range 200V – 650V
Start-Up Voltage 180V
Max. PV Input Current 28A x 2 = 56A
MPPT Channels 2
Nominal Output Voltage 3L/N/PE 220V/380V or 3L/N/PE 230V/400V
Nominal Output Frequency 50/60Hz (+/-0.2%) Configurable
Max. Bypass Current 63A
Transfer Time 10ms
Max. Efficiency 97.6%
Battery to Load Efficiency 94.0%
MPPT Efficiency 99.9%
Protection Rating IP65
Operating Temperature Range -20°C to +50°C (>35°C Derating)
Dimensions 620 x 585 x 225mm
Weight 42kg
